| { |
| "entries": [ |
| { |
| "attribute_name": "VDD_AVSBUS_RAIL", |
| "lower_bound": 0, |
| "upper_bound": 15, |
| "scalar_increment": 1, |
| "default_value": 0, |
| // This BIOS attribute has a D-Bus property as backend. |
| "dbus": { |
| "object_path": "/xyz/openbmc_project/avsbus", |
| "interface": "xyz.openbmc.AvsBus.Manager", |
| "property_type": "uint8_t", |
| "property_name": "Rail" |
| } |
| }, |
| { |
| // This is an example of BIOS Integer Read only attribute |
| "attribute_name": "SBE_IMAGE_MINIMUM_VALID_ECS", |
| "lower_bound": 1, |
| "upper_bound": 15, |
| "scalar_increment": 1, |
| "default_value": 2 |
| }, |
| { |
| // This atttribute has invalid default value or scalar_increment, when |
| // scalar_increment=2 and lower_bound=1, default_value must be 1, 3, 5... |
| "attribute_name": "INTEGER_INVALID_CASE", |
| "lower_bound": 1, |
| "upper_bound": 15, |
| "scalar_increment": 2, |
| "default_value": 4 |
| } |
| ] |
| } |